(Clearwisdom.net) Falun Gong practitioner Mr. Wang Gang, 39, is from Xiweituo Village, Tunzhou City, Heibei Province. In 2005, he had been in prison for two years when his right leg, which had been severely injured due to torture, was amputated in Baoding Prison. When his worried family went to visit him in Jidong Prison on August 18, 2007, they were driven out by more than 40 guards.

In July 2003, Mr. Wang Gang was sent to Baoding Prison, Hebei Province (also called the No. 1 Prison of Hebei Province) to serve a 10-year sentence for not giving up Falun Gong. Mr. Wang suffered inhumane torture for his firm belief in Falun Gong. The head of the prison, Gao Yingm, ordered guards and inmates to brutally torture him. The head of the prison affairs section, Fan Jianli, beat him and disabled his right leg. In late May 2005, Mr. Wang was forced to have his right leg amputated against his will and without notifying his family.

On August 23, 2006, one year and three months after the tragedy, Mr. Wang Gang managed to notify his family of the bad news.

The heads of Baoding Prison had tried their best to cover up the tragedy. On May 24, 2007, and June 7, 2007, Mr. Wang's wife, his mother-in-law, his sister, and his brother went to Baoding Prison to visit him, but they were told by the prison heads that the news of his amputation was a rumor, and none of the family was allowed to see or even peek at Mr. Wang Gang because he had not yet been "transformed." In the end, Mr. Wang's family members had no other choice but to leave.

In early June 2007, Mr. Wang Gang was transferred from Baoding Prison to Jidong Prison in Tangshan City. By that time, he had been disabled due to the amputation for over two years. On June 28, 2007, his wife finally found out the truth in a letter he wrote to her. On the morning of August 6, his wife and son, Tianyu, finally saw him. Seeing his horrible situation, his wife sobbed.

Jidong Prison authorities told Ms. Ren Cuijing that when Mr. Wang was transferred to Jidong Prison, a medical exam revealed that her husband was suffering from vasculitis in his left leg and that it might have to be amputated as well. However, Mr. Wang was not told this information about his physical condition when he was transferred.

His family was very worried about his wellbeing. At 2:00 a.m. on August 18, 2007--the day the prison allowed family visits--Mr. Wang's wife, Ms. Ren Cuijing; his sister, Ms. Wang Yuzhi; his older brother, Mr. Wang Xin; and four more relatives drove a rented car to the No. 4 Division of Jidong Prison in Tangshan City, Heibei Province, to visit him. Mr. Wang's relatives drove 500 kilometers for over nine hours. When they finally arrived at the prison at 11:00 a.m., however, they had missed the morning visiting time. Prison education section deputy head Mr. Wu Likun told Ms. Ren, "We need to discuss your request. I will let you know in the afternoon."

At around 2:30 p.m., Wu Likun called Mr. Wang's family members to a conference room. Division head Hao Baoxin and some others were also present. Wu Likun and others rejected the family's request to visit, saying that too many people were present and some were not direct family members. Ms. Wang Yuzhi asked, "Why was Wang Gang's leg amputated? Persecuting Wang Gang is illegal." Hao Baoxin became very angry. He slammed the table with his fist and yelled, "I don't want you to stay here for even one more minute. You must leave now." Immediately, over 40 prison guards rushed into the room and pushed Mr. Wang Gang's family members out of the prison.
